Canada will take on the United States for gold in men’s hockey at Milano Cortina 2026 on Sunday morning.
With NHL players back at the Olympics for the first time in 12 years, it’s arguably the signature event of the Games with the rivalry matchup that most hockey fans were begging for in the final.
It’s the final event of the Games before the closing ceremony Sunday night, which means a 2:10 pm local start time in Italy and a 5:10 am PT puck drop on the west coast of Canada.

While the majority of hockey fans will saunter from their bed to couch for the game, others will want to venture out to watch the game at a local bar with other like-minded hockey fans.
To make that possible, British Columbia Premier David Eby announced Friday night that bars and restaurants can open early for the occasion if they choose.
“Our province is so proud of our Canada men’s hockey team,” he wrote in a social media post. “Also happy to say you can celebrate at one of our local BC hospitality locations with a licensed beverage starting at 5 am Sunday, where local governments allow.”
So if you’d rather watch with dozens of other screaming fans while sipping a cold pint or Baileys and coffee, call your local establishment or check their social media pages to see if they’ll be opening up for the game.
